First Vax-2-School winners announced
COLUMBUS – The first 30 winners of Ohio’s Vax-2-School program were announced Monday evening.
Monday’s drawing was for $10,000 scholarships.

The Vax-2-School plan will give away a total of $2 million in scholarships to vaccinated Ohioans ages 5-25. The prizes are 150 $10,000 and five $100,000 scholarships to any Ohio college or university or career or technical education.
